Yesterday, Right Wing Extreme announced that it will not be participating in the Burn a Quran day event planned by Dove World Outreach in Gainesville. According to their website, the group’s leadership determined “this event does not glorify GOD in way that leads the lost to Jesus Christ.” Adding “the liberal media is intentionally using stories such as the burning of the Koran to distract, divide, and enrage the public.”
They further asked their brothers in Christ at Dove World Outreach to not hold the book burning because “it may diminish the work of the Holy Spirit to witness to Muslims.”
No word yet on whether Dove World Outreach will head Right Wing Extreme’s call for moderation or whether they will instead continue with their plans to burn Qurans on Burn a Quran Day.
Right Wing Extreme is an armed Christian militia that was founded in April 2009 in response to the growing concern from law enforcement about armed right wing extremist groups. They adhere to a code of chivalry that takes its imagery and language from the romanticized idea of chivalrous medieval knights.
On the plus side, they do promise to “be obedient in all things to the commands of ladies.” Other good news is that almost 60% of their members, according to the poll on their website, are aware Barack Obama is not a Muslim. Though that does mean a full 37% think he is.
Final analysis: A group of armed Christians who like to pretend they are chivalrous medieval knights are providing a moderating voice in the debate over Quran burning.
